Crude Oil Futures Rise on Spot Demand
New Delhi, May 20 (PTI) Crude oil prices on Wednesday rose by Rs 47 to Rs 10,074 per barrel in futures trade, as participants increased their positions following firm spot demand.

On the Multi Commodity Exchange, crude oil for June delivery traded higher by Rs 47 or 0.47 per cent at Rs 10,074 per barrel in 3,060 lots.


Analysts said the rise of bets by participants kept crude oil prices higher in futures trade.

However, globally West Texas Intermediate crude was trading 0.31 per cent lower at USD 110.81 per barrel, while Brent crude fell 0.42 per cent to USD 106.98 per barrel in New York.
